A terrified kitten is recovering from its accidents after it grew to become caught in a controversial ‘glue lure.’

The feline believed to be 4 months old, had grow to be caught within the lure which consists of plastic or cardboard with non-drying glue designed to lure rodents. A member of the general public had noticed the ginger kitten, now named Basil, and rushed him to a neighborhood vet. The vet needed to sedate Basil with a purpose to take away all of the glue caught on his fur which had been contaminated with grime and different particles.




It is believed the kitten had been feral and had gotten caught within the lure set in a shed in Great Fransham, Norfolk whereas desperately looking for meals. RSPCA inspector Dean Astillberry stated: “This poor little lad was in a really sorry state and clearly distressed and scared by what had occurred to him.

“The glue was throughout his fur and you would see that he had been attempting in useless to get it off him. We assume that he is feral or has not had any actual contact with people. It was heartbreaking to see him in such a determined scenario. The vet crew had been wonderful and frolicked gently washing and shaving away his glued fur which had lined almost all his physique.”

Basil ought to make a full restoration in time however was very fortunate to be discovered when he was – and the RSPCA Mid Norfolk and North Suffolk hope he might be rehomed. Chloe Shorten, head of animal welfare on the department stated: “Basil Glue Kitten as we affectionately name him is doing very well and actually beginning to belief us.

“This little boy has been via a lot and was so shy, it is solely now his character is beginning to come via. He’s so shy he solely performs along with his toys at evening when he thinks nobody is round.” The Glue Traps (Offences) Act was handed in 2022 banning the traps which the RSPCA name “merciless”.

The ban was anticipated to come back into drive in England in April 2024 however has now been delayed till July 2024. There are some exemptions to the ban beneath licence, with pest controllers nonetheless ready to make use of them.
